"Veer-Zaara" (2004) is a highly-regarded romantic drama starring Shah Rukh Khan, Preity Zinta, and Rani Mukerji, which was the highest-grossing Indian film of its year, earning ₹976.4 million globally. The film received a 20th-anniversary theatrical re-release in late 2024, screening on over 600 screens, and remains accessible on authorized platforms such as Netflix and Prime Video.
